The Linux kernel is prone to a local denial-of-service vulnerability. This issue is due to a flaw in the 'proc' filesystem.

This vulnerability allows local users to cause a kernel panic, denying further service to legitimate users.

This issue affects Linux kernel versions 2.6.15 through 2.6.17-rc5 on multiprocessor computers running SMP kernels. Other kernel versions may also be affected.
